The uniform interleaver makes independent weight distributions of the parity check sequences generated by the first and second encoders. With this definition, we can easily obtain the conditional WEF of the overall PCBC by           w K A Z A Z A Z C w C C w w P ( ) ( ) ( ) 1 2 (4.57) For a parallel concatenated code p consisting of M constituent codes and M-1 uniform interleavers of length K, its conditional WEF is related to the conditional WEF of its constituent codes by 1 1 ( ) ( ) m P M C w C m w M A Z A Z K w           (4.58) As an example, Fig. 4.21 shows the distance spectrum of a turbo code of rate 1/3. Fig. 4.21. The distance spectrum of a turbo code of rate 1/3. Info length K=400, N=1200, memory=5.
